WHAT DOES PYTHON WEB SCRAPING , DATA MINING MEAN?

What Does python web scraping , data mining Mean?

What Does python web scraping , data mining Mean?

Blog Article

nevertheless, most of this data is not available inside a structured structure which can be very easily analyzed. This is where World wide web scraping and data mining are available in.

let us replicate the exact same method with the remaining two libraries. Now We'll exhibit the way to use Pyppeteer to gather dynamic articles from the webpage.

Window dimensions: make sure the browser window is sized correctly for what really should be captured. If the window is simply too compact, some aspects of the site is likely to be Slash off.

For deal management and virtual environments, I like to recommend using Poetry. It truly is productive and integrates nicely together with your workflow. Here's how so as to add Selenium to your Python challenge:

this will likely output the textual content ‘This really is an example HTML document.’ which is the content with the tag within the HTML document.

usually, the information of a dynamic Web content can only be received right after it has completely loaded. consequently, the approaches by which it might be received are limited to the ones that allow the Online page to completely load just before its material is retrieved.

Set Window measurement: Optionally, you'll be able to set the window measurement to make sure that the screenshot captures all the website page as required. This phase is especially helpful Should the default window dimension will not seize the whole web site content material or in case you need a certain screenshot resolution.

any more info time you execute this script, Selenium will start Chrome in headless manner, navigate to Nintendo's Web page, and print the page supply. This output lets you see the whole HTML written content in the webpage, which can be very handy for scraping or debugging.

Selenium Grid is a robust Instrument that enhances the scalability of Website scraping and automatic screening by allowing for you to run your Selenium scripts on a number of devices and browsers at the same time.

Data mining may be used to classify information articles or blog posts into various groups, like politics, athletics, and enjoyment. This may enable information corporations and publishers greater comprehend their audience and tailor their material accordingly.

the 1st library that comes to brain In terms of scraping is BeautifulSoup. nevertheless, as we stated in other our content, BS4 only enables you to parse the HTML code of the website page and cannot get it on its own.

If that every one Appears specially tangled, don’t force! Python and exquisite Soup have purely natural attributes proposed for making this for the most part rapid.

To begin with, it's important to notice that Scrapy does not consist of its headless browser, that means it are not able to load Websites ahead of processing them. on the other hand, referring to Scrapy's official documentation reveals a committed section on scraping dynamic Internet websites.

most significantly, you should go with the data basically to grasp what degradations lie from the data resources. you are able to do this utilizing a library like Pandas (offered in Python). At The purpose Once your evaluation is completed, you should to make a compound to eliminate the deformities in data resources and normalize the data facilities that are not as per the Other individuals. you'd then accomplish massive checks to assist whether or not the data centers have every one of the data inside a singular data variety.

Report this page